Compare all specifications:
1998 Aston Martin Project Vantage | 1978 Ferrari 308 | |
Make | Aston Martin | Ferrari |
Model | Project Vantage | 308 |
Year Released | 1998 | 1978 |
Engine Position | Front | Middle |
Engine Size | 6000 cc | 2927 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 12 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Horse Power | 450 HP | 255 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 7700 RPM |
Torque | 746 Nm | 283 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 89 mm | 81 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 80 mm | 71 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.0:1 | 8.8:1 |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Vehicle Weight | 1554 kg | 1365 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4670 mm | 4310 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1900 mm | 1720 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1300 mm | 1220 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2700 mm | 2560 mm |
